Join us for an outdoor meditation workshop in the tranquil setting of Hitchin Lavender.
These sessions approach meditation as an embodied practice of attention: a way of slowing down, listening more deeply, and creating space for reflection, steadiness and reorientation. Working in direct relation to landscape, atmosphere and the needs of the group, the workshops invite participants into a more conscious relationship with breath, thought, feeling and imagination.
Rather than offering meditation simply as relaxation, these sessions explore how practice can reshape the way we meet stress, uncertainty and inner noise. Through guided meditations, visualisations and reflective exercises, participants are supported to develop greater calm, clarity and presence, while also strengthening their capacity to stay with what matters.
Each workshop is experiential and responsive to the group. Some sessions may be more restorative, others more reflective, but all are grounded in the belief that meditation can help us come into a more truthful and sustainable relationship with ourselves, our attention and the lives we are living.
The Meditation Workshops at Hitchin Lavender are suitable for all levels of experience, whether you are completely new to meditation or looking to deepen an existing practice.
John Harrigan is an artist working across film, performance and writing, and a PhD researcher in Arts & Humanities at the Royal College of Art. His workshops are informed by his research into how meaning, transformation and authorship emerge through embodied practice, ritual process and lived experience. He has facilitated meditation, art and reflective practice workshops for organisations including the Royal College of Art, the Institute of Contemporary Arts, Wilderness Festival, the Royal Central School of Speech and Drama and the BBC.
